Its the data disks that dont swap, not multi disk games.
Data disks are like the extra VR missions for MGS, where you need to have MGS to play the VR missions. Its the same with GTA London, you need GTA to run GTA london. So by what has been on the board these games will not work on PS2. When I say games I mean the data disks not the games that need to be loaded to play a data disk.
